Strong's Concordance H4127

Original Word: מוּג
Transliteration: mûwg
Phonetic Spelling: moog
a primitive root; to melt, i.e. literally (to soften, flow down, disappear), or figuratively (to fear, faint); consume, dissolve, (be) faint(-hearted), melt (away), make soft.
